The radius of a circle is 13 in. Find its area in terms of pi​

Answer:

π169

Step-by-step explanation:

Area of a circle =π[tex]r^{2}[/tex]  

In this question r (radius) is 13

Plug in 13

π[tex]13^{2}[/tex]

13x13=169

π169
